The Future Of Financial Services: Embracing Digital Transformation

In today’s fast-paced and technologically advanced world, digital transformation has become a phrase synonymous with progress and innovation The financial services industry is no exception to this ever-evolving trend As companies strive to keep up with changing consumer expectations and emerging technologies, digital transformation has become a key strategy for success.

Digital transformation in financial services refers to the integration of digital technology into all aspects of financial operations, fundamentally changing how organizations operate and deliver value to their customers From customer experience to risk management, digital transformation has the potential to revolutionize the industry, making financial services more accessible, efficient, and secure.

One significant area where digital transformation is making an impact is customer experience Traditional financial institutions are often burdened by lengthy and bureaucratic processes that deter customers from engaging with their services However, by embracing digital transformation, financial service providers can reimagine their customer journeys, making them more seamless and convenient.

For instance, customers can now open bank accounts and apply for loans online, eliminating the need for extensive paperwork and physical visits to the bank Moreover, advancements in art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ning have enabled financial institutions to offer personalized recommendations and financial advice tailored to individuals’ unique needs and goals, ensuring a more personalized experience.

Digital transformation also allows financial service providers to leverage big data analytics, providing valuable insights into customer behavior and preferences This data-driven approach enhances the ability to understand customer needs and deliver personalized experiences By leveraging data analytics, financial institutions can make informed decisions regarding product offerings, marketing campaigns, and risk assessment, enabling them to stay ahead of the competition.

Another area of digital transformation in financial services is the automation of processes Manual processes are not only time-consuming but also prone to errors Deloitte estimates that automation can reduce operational costs by up to 70% in some areas By automating routine tasks, such as data entry and compliance checks, financial institutions can free up valuable human resources and streamline their operations Digital Transformation for Financial Services. This not only improves efficiency but also minimizes the risk of human error, resulting in greater accuracy and reliability.

Furthermore, digital transformation has also introduced new and innovative ways of accessing financial services The rise of financial technology (Fintech) companies has disrupted the traditional financial services landscape These companies specialize in providing innovative, technology-driven financial solutions, often focusing on areas such as payments, lending, and investment management.

Fintech companies leverage digital technology to offer services that are faster, more affordable, and convenient compared to traditional financial institutions Mobile payment apps, peer-to-peer lending platforms, and robo-advisors are just a few examples of Fintech solutions transforming the financial industry Through partnerships or the development of in-house digital capabilities, traditional financial institutions can capitalize on these advancements and expand their service offerings.

However, with increased digitalization, the financial services industry also faces new challenges and risks Cybersecurity breaches and data privacy issues have become more prevalent, making robust security measures and risk management strategies critical Financial service providers must invest in cybersecurity technologies and protocols to protect sensitive customer information and maintain trust.
